Visitors to Heritage Park are in for some unexpected noise and inconvenience this week. The Department of Enterprise Services has announced that from April 15 to 19, certain walking trails will be intermittently closed between 7:30 a.m. and 2:30 p.m. This is due to the department's decision to lay down gravel to improve the paths. While this will eventually make weekend hikes more enjoyable, for now, park-goers will have to find alternative routes or deal with the disruption.

Despite the inconvenience, the upgrades are expected to enhance the park experience in the long run. The department assures that signs will be posted to help guide pedestrians around the work areas. However, it's worth noting that the project's timeline may be extended if weather conditions, such as rain, interfere with the work.
